			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Cattleya orchids can be amazing to grow at home or in your greenhouse. Care conditions of Cattleya orchids can be created by the beginner or advanced orchid grower. The Cattleya orchid is also known as the queen of orchids. There is an extensive range in the number of colors and sizes for Cattleya orchids. Plant sizes range from the size of a teacup to over 6 feet in height. Cattleyas flowers come in white, lavender, yellow, red, orange, purple, and blended colors. Flower sizes range from inches to almost a foot in diameter.</p>
<p>Here are care conditions of Cattleya orchids:</p>
<p><strong>Light:</strong> Bright light to some direct sun when not at brightest, no direct sun in the middle of the day, east, shaded south or west window, 2000-3000 footcandles when in a greenhouse.<br />
<strong>Watering: </strong>Cattleyas almost like to dry out between waterings, seedlings need constant moisture.<br />
<strong>Humidity: </strong>Cattleyas prefer 50-80% humidity.<br />
<strong>Air movement: </strong>Cattletas like good air movement.<br />
<strong>Potting media: Cattleya orchids like to be potted in medium to large bark.<br />
Fertilizing: </strong>When growing Cattleyas in fir bark use a 30-10-10 fertilizer, otherwise use 20-20-20, in active growth fertilize every two weeks, otherwise fertilize once per month.<br />
<strong>Repotting: </strong>When your Cattleya plant starts overgrowing the pot or the rhizome protrudes over the edge of the pot, repot. When repotting, soak the roots first for an hour.</p>
